Nearly all PPFA clinics give abortion referrals, and from 2011-2014 Planned Parenthood actually performed over 1.3 million abortions (www.frc.org/plannedparenthoodfacts). Former PPFA head Alan Guttmacher said, "...the only avenue (we can) travel to win the battle for abortion on demand is through sex education" (via "Sex Education and Mental Health Report"). Do you want schools to educate your children to practice "abortion on demand"?
The PPFA "Federation Declaration" affirms, "our fundamental mission (is) making contraceptive ... services available to all who want and need them, regardless of age..." Do you want your daughter, regardless of age, to obtain contraceptives without your knowledge or consent? This is exactly one service PPFA provides.
"The Great Orgasm Robbery" is a PPFA publication that tells young people who are courting: "Sex is fun ... Do what gives pleasure and enjoy what gives pleasure and ask for what gives pleasure. Don't rob yourself of joy by focusing on old-fashioned ideas about what's 'normal' or 'nice,' just communicate and enjoy."
Another PPFA publication is "Sex Alphabet." It says: "Being a homosexual does not mean that a man or woman carries out strange practices. For homosexuals, lovemaking is as normal as it is for heterosexuals."
The Bible, however, teaches that the sexual relationship is honorable only within marriage between a man and a woman (Hebrews 13:4; 1 Corinthians 6:9-11). Will you allow PPFA to use the schools to instill its doctrines in your children?
